#1d1408 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d1408 is composed of 11.4% red, 7.8%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31% magenta, 72.4% yellow and 88.6% black. It has a hue angle of 34.3 degrees, a saturation of 56.8% and a lightness of 7.3%. #1d1408 color hex could be obtained by blending #3a2810 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

● #1d1408 color description : Very dark (mostly black) orange [Brown tone].
#1d1408 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d1408 has RGB values of R:29, G:20,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.31, Y:0.72, K:0.89. Its decimal value is 1905672.

Shades and Tints of #1d1408
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0904 is the darkest color, while #fffef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d1408
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#131312 is the less saturated color, while #241501 is the most saturated one.
